Rojin Kabaiş investigation reveals conflicting forensic and digital evidence

The investigation into the death of Rojin Kabaiş, a university student found in Van, has revealed conflicting forensic and digital evidence. The family's lawyer, Abdurrahman Karabulut, asserts that Kabaiş was murdered by being drugged with Ornidazole and the muscle relaxant Rocuronium. He argues that because Rocuronium has a short half-life of 30 to 90 minutes, its presence in her stomach and organs cannot be attributed to a surgery she underwent on September 11, 2024.

Conversely, the Forensic Medicine Institute (ATK) report suggests the Rocuronium found is consistent with her previous surgery, noting the substance can remain detectable for up to two months. The institute stated there was no medical evidence of poisoning or traumatic injury, and that alcohol levels found were consistent with natural decomposition.

Digital forensics have added further complexity. Expert analysis of Xiaomi activity logs indicates that Kabaiş's Google account was accessed via SMS on October 1, 2024, while she was still missing. Furthermore, a 'device deletion' command was executed on October 10, 2024, from an IP address linked to Van and another appearing to be from the Czech Republic. Efforts to unlock the phone in Spain and China were unsuccessful, though the deletion occurred while the device was in custody.

Additionally, the autopsy report noted the presence of DNA from two different men in the chest and vaginal areas of the deceased. Legal representatives have requested the detention of two suspects based on digital traces and HTS records.
